Market Snapshot: Commercial UV Water Purifier Market Outlook
The commercial UV water purifier market is projected to expand from USD 413.63 million in 2024 to USD 432.91 million in 2025, ultimately reaching USD 596.98 million by 2032, with a steady CAGR of 4.69%. This sustained growth highlights rising regulatory demands, the adoption of innovative water treatment solutions in enterprise settings, and a transition towards more automated and interconnected purification systems. Implementation is accelerating particularly in food production, healthcare, pharmaceuticals, and laboratory industries, as businesses focus on operational safety and sustainability. Increasing use of real-time monitoring and system integration also helps organizations achieve better risk management and ensure compliance.
Scope & Segmentation
- Technology: Filtered UV, Low Pressure Mercury, Medium Pressure Mercury, and Submersible UV systems allow for tailored solutions in microbial control, providing flexibility with process integration, energy efficiency, and automation.
- Application: Core segments include food and beverage (covering bottled water, brewing, dairy, and juices), healthcare (clinics and hospitals), hospitality, laboratories, and pharmaceuticals (such as API production and formulations). Each sector demands high standards for water quality and safety as part of regulatory and operational outcomes.
- Flow Rate: Solution categories—High Flow (over 1000 L/h), Medium Flow (500–1000 L/h), or Low Flow (under 500 L/h)—address diverse site capacities and workflow needs, ensuring suitability for varying enterprise contexts.
- Distribution Channel: Delivery occurs through Direct Sales (original equipment manufacturers and regional teams), Distributors (local and national coverage), and Online channels (including manufacturer and third-party platforms) to accommodate installation, procurement speed, and ongoing maintenance requirements.
- Regions: The Americas (including North America and Latin America), Europe, Middle East & Africa, and Asia-Pacific are covered, each with tailored compliance and operational approaches to meet local water conditions and regulations.

United States Tariff Impact on UV Water Purification Supply Chains
New United States tariffs come into effect in 2025, increasing production costs for commercial UV water purifier manufacturers that rely on imported lamp and electronic components. These measures have influenced overall pricing, total cost of ownership, and extended procurement timelines. Industry stakeholders are reacting by pivoting toward more regionalized supply chains, reinforcing local inventories, and expanding domestic assembly to maintain operational resilience and support business continuity.
